/* CSS Document */

/* CSS Document */

/*stili per il layout fluido*/
html,body{margin: 24px 0 0 0;padding:0}
body{font-family: arial,sans-serif;font-size: 76%; background-color:#DEDBCD;}

h1 {margin:0; padding:0;}
h2 {margin:0; padding:0;}

form {margin:0; padding:0; }
img {border:0;}

div#boxHP{
	position:absolute;
	width:960px;
	left:50%;
	margin:0 0 0 -480px;
	}
	
#HPtestata {
	height:291px;
	background-image: url(../image/imgtestataHP2.jpg);
	background-repeat: no-repeat;
	background-position: left top;
}
#HPmenu { height:27px; background-color:#F2F1EB; padding:12px 0 0 5px;}
#HPboxcontenuti { height:219px; background-color:#FFFFFF; padding:15px;}
#HPboxcontenuti h1{color:#00247D; margin:0; padding:0; font-size:1.5em; border-bottom: 1px dashed #00247D}
#HPboxcontenuti h2{color:#00247D; margin:0; padding:0; font-size:1.3em;}


#HPpiede {
	height:28px;
	background-image: url(../image/sfondopiede2.gif);
	background-repeat: no-repeat;
	background-position: left top;
	color:#555555;
	font-weight: bold;
	padding:5px 0 0 0;
	text-align:center;
}
#HPlogo {}

.txtnews {font-size:0.9em; line-height:18px; margin-top:10px; margin-right:5px; padding:5px;}
.titolone {color:#00247D; margin:0; padding:0; font-size:1.4em; font-weight:bold}

#primoPiano {
	float:left; 
	width:290px; 
	border-right:1px solid #555555; 
	padding:9px; 	
	/*noIEmac\*/
	min-height: 200px;
	height: auto !important;
	/*end */
	height:200px;}
#documenti {
	float:left;
	width:290px; 
	border-right:1px solid #555555; 
	padding:9px;
	/*noIEmac\*/
	min-height: 200px;
	height: auto !important;
	/*end */
	height:200px;}
#cerca {
	float:left; 
	width:290px; 
	padding:9px;
	/*noIEmac\*/
	min-height: 200px;
	height: auto !important;
	/*end */
	height:200px;}
	
a:link{color:#565656;text-decoration:underline;}
a:visited{color:#565656;text-decoration:underline;}
a:hover {color:#C41B1E;text-decoration:none;}
a:active {color:#C41B1E;text-decoration:none;}

.boxnews { width:280px;}
.boxnews h3{margin:0; padding:0; font-size:1em; font-weight:bold; color:#555555;}

.immaginenews {padding:0 0 8px 0;}

/*-------RICERCA-------*/
form {margin:0; padding:0;}
#boxricerca {}

.H1label {font-weight:bold; color:#555555;}
.campoRIC {border:1px solid #00247D;; color:#000;}
.bottoneRIC {border:0px solid #00247D; color:#FFF; background-color:#00247D;}




